shift handle acting strange

Ive got a 97 S320 with 130k miles on it. Its an amazing car, amazingly nimble for its size.. ( Still seems small compared to some of my other cars..

I've driven it over 40k miles, across country and back, only an occasional annoyance.

anway, its just developed a strange problem-

the shift lever does not want to go below Drive. It just wont move over , as though its locked or blocked. anyone seen this ? how hard is it to fix?

The problem is in the shifter mechanism in the selector box. The linkage is seized, probably from rust. You'll need to have the selector box disassembled completely to free it up and lube it.

with my 95 s320, it is necessary to move the shift lever over to the left, from the D position to the 4 position, then it will move down to the 3 and 2 positions. If you try and pull straight down from D it won't go
